When I first learned about Amazon’s decision to patent the “one-click purchase” technology, I was floored by its simplicity and genius. I remember thinking, How could something so basic become so powerful? It was a few years ago, and I was reading about innovations in e-commerce. Amazon’s one-click checkout wasn’t just a convenience, it was a revolution. By eliminating extra steps in the buying process, they capitalized on human nature’s desire for ease and immediacy. Later, I discovered that Apple licensed the same technology for its App Store, reinforcing its value. Here were two global giants, not competing over flashy features, but over simplicity. This realization stayed with me, nagging at how it applied to smaller businesses. I felt a sudden urgency to rethink everything I knew about customer experience. That discovery transformed how I approached sales and customer journeys. It wasn’t just about offering great products or services; it was about reducing friction at every step. I began noticing examples everywhere. Why do some apps feel so intuitive while others frustrate us? Why do some websites convert visitors into buyers effortlessly while others struggle? It all came back to this principle of simplicity: fewer clicks, fewer barriers, and a seamless experience. Over time, I saw how my business mindset shifted. I began advocating for app and web solutions designed to remove friction, especially for SMEs who often neglect this crucial detail. The moment it clicked was when I realized simplicity wasn’t just a strategy, it was the secret to customer loyalty. Today, my approach revolves around helping SMEs embrace this idea. Whether it’s through mobile apps or web development, reducing friction is non-negotiable. Customers are impatient and expect ease. Simplifying processes isn’t a luxury; it’s a competitive necessity. Amazon and Apple’s success isn’t about luck; it’s about respecting this reality. SMEs who adopt this mindset can unlock growth they didn’t know was possible. Friction kills sales. Eliminate it, and you create a path to loyalty and growth.  Simplifying the customer journey is the single most impactful change your business can make, because in today’s fast-paced world, simplicity sells.

Artificial Intelligence (AI) is no longer a futuristic concept, it’s here, and it’s reshaping how businesses engage with customers through mobile apps. From automated customer support to AI-powered personalization, businesses that embrace AI are seeing higher engagement, increased revenue, and improved efficiency. If you’re a business owner, now is the time to understand how AI can give your business a competitive edge in the mobile space. 1. AI Creates Hyper-Personalized User Experiences Customers today expect more than just a standard app, they want an experience tailored to them. AI helps businesses deliver: Smart recommendations based on past behavior, similar to Netflix and Amazon Dynamic app interfaces that adjust content and layouts to user preferences Predictive analytics that anticipate customer needs before they search for them The result is higher engagement, increased app usage, and stronger customer loyalty. 2. AI-Powered Chatbots & Customer Support AI chatbots are revolutionizing customer service by providing: 24/7 instant responses to inquiries Intelligent, context-aware conversations that improve over time Seamless integration with customer databases for personalized support Businesses that use AI chatbots report up to 30% lower customer service costs while improving response times and customer satisfaction. 3. Voice & Image Recognition – The Next Wave of Engagement Voice assistants like Siri, Alexa, and Google Assistant have made voice search mainstream, and now businesses are leveraging: Voice-enabled apps for hands-free interactions AI-driven image recognition for shopping, security, and accessibility E-commerce apps using image search see up to 40% higher conversions, as customers can search for products using photos instead of text. 4. AI Automation Saves Time & Increases Efficiency AI isn’t just about improving the user experience, it helps businesses work smarter by: Automating appointment scheduling and reminders Sending AI-generated push notifications based on customer activity Detecting fraud in transactions and online payments Businesses that integrate AI-driven automation cut down on manual tasks, reduce costs, and improve operational efficiency. 5. AI Helps Businesses Increase Revenue AI is optimizing monetization strategies, helping businesses boost sales and profits with: Smart pricing models that adjust based on demand and user behavior AI-driven ad targeting for more effective marketing Predictive analytics that forecast customer spending habits Apps using AI-based pricing strategies see up to a 25% increase in revenue compared to traditional pricing models.  What This Means for Business Owners AI is no longer a luxury for large corporations, it’s a necessity for businesses looking to stay competitive in the digital age. Whether you’re in retail, hospitality, fitness, or professional services, an AI-powered mobile app can: Improve customer retention and engagement Reduce operational costs with smart automation Increase sales and profitability through intelligent insights Thinking about developing an app?
